Three of Four Searches in UK Conducted on Google Sites

Google Sites slightly increased their lead in June as the most popular search property in the UK to 75.3% of all search queries, followed by eBay (5.5%), Yahoo Sites (4.3%) and Microsoft Sites (3.4%), according to a comScore?analysis.

AOL LLC’s acquisition of UK social networking property Bebo.com expanded its share of search queries to 2.3%, edging out Facebook.com (2.2%) for sixth place.

Other findings from June 2008:

  • Some 3.9 billion total searches were conducted in the UK during the month.
  • 31 million UK internet users conducted at least one search.
  • UK searchers conducted an average of 124 searches per searcher during the month, or 4.1 searches per day.
